A Panel discussion on Gender and Forestry in "Integrative Science for Integrative Management", IUFRO Division 6 conference. 14-20 August 2007, Saariselkä, Finland

Integration occurs across many boundaries including geographic, administrative, ownership, time, and academic disciplines. This All-Division 6 IUFRO conference will focus on science conducted across the many different dimensions of integration and how such science relates to integrated land management. Issues of research administration, educational and scientific outreach, policy, recreation/tourism/nature conservation, forest and environmental history, gender studies, environmental economics, forest terminology, social and community studies, natural resource governance, and many other fields should be able to find a place in this important theme which cuts across time and space, national boundaries, and academic disciplines.
